Union Finance Minister Nirmala Sitharaman slammed Congress leader Rahul Gandhi on Thursday for making baseless allegations against Prime Minister Narendra Modi over the Adani project, calling him a “repeat offender.”
She said while responding to questions at the state BJP office in New Delhi that “If Rahul Gandhi really thinks that Adani has been given all these things (undue favours), it is not true,” She added further that “Let me also say he’s now becoming a repeat offender in terms of putting baseless allegations against the Prime Minister. We saw that prior to the 2019 elections, and now he’s doing it again. He doesn’t seem to learn any lessons from all these false allegations that he wants to level against the Prime Minister.”
“It was the (then) Congress government (in Kerala), which gave on a platter the Vizhinjam Port to Adani. It was not given on the basis of any tender. Now, this is not this (Congress) government but the CPM government. But what stopped him from asking and demanding that Kerala cancel that order?” she alleged. She also questioned why Gandhi did not speak out against the Kerala government’s “undue favour” to Adani and a solar power project awarded to the company in Rajasthan.
The “entire solar power project” has been given to Adani in (Congress-ruled) Rajasthan. “What stops Rahul Gandhi?” she added.
